I had no idea that not far from Kemer, at a distance of 15 km, there is another Hidden Paradise...
Cennet koyu
And I would never have gotten there and would not have learned about this place if my friend had not taken me there on a moped.
We drove in the direction of the city of Chamyuva and then moved through the pine forest. Suddenly, I saw a beautiful, cozy bay among high rocks covered with pine forest! It was Sunday, and there were many people on the beach.
Since we like more quiet places, we decided to go up the forest path above the sea in search of a more secluded place.
The path ran along the edge of the rock, so you had to move carefully. I stopped to look at the beautiful scenery that opened my view from above. Two people swam at depth. It was exciting!
The majestic pine trees on the edge of the cliff created beautiful pictures against the background of the turquoise Mediterranean Sea, which looked so deep and magical!
The path climbed up between the spiky stones of the Turkish forest. The unique aroma of needles was in the air. I was enjoying the warm September day. This is the best time to walk in Turkey, when the heat is no unbearable, but the weather is still great!
We moved further and we saw another small bay hidden behind the pine trees that were above the sea.
People set up a swing on one tree :)
Then the forest ended and there were stone beaches above the sea, which formed amazing shores with many cliffs and recesses.
We found a cozy place where you could safely go into the sea so as not to injure your legs. There were interesting baths in which the water was heated more and you could enjoy the warm water.
